I unchecked the box to msn messenger in the add/remove
windows components. However the messenger keeps loading
everytime I start windows, and when I end it in windows
task manager under processes, it restarts a few minutes
later and causes my Star Wars Galaxies game to constantly
crash. I find this very annoying and the crash is so bad
I have to do a hard shut down every time and that isn't
good for my computer. I have also unchecked the start-up
of the messenger in ms config in the only 2 areas I found
it. MSN messenger isn't a service it's a virus and it is
NOT on a virus list.
Any help on removing it completely will be greatly
appreciated. TIA

Greetings Jen,

Do you have Norton Antivirus 2003 installed? Norton added a new "instant messaging scanning"
feature to Norton Antivirus 2003, which can conflict with Messenger and cause some of this
behavior. To stop it, open Norton Antivirus (Right-click on the Norton Antivirus icon in the
System Tray/Notification Area (by the clock), choose 'Open Norton Antivirus'), click Options,
then Instant Messenger then uncheck MSN Instant Messenger and click OK.
